

Multi-award-winning artist Fanny Lumsden has confirmed plans for a national tour, commencing in February to hit all capital cities. This exciting announcement follows the release of her new single “Look At Me Now” and comes just weeks after a successful European tour and her current national arena tour with beloved singer songwriter, Paul Kelly.
Kicking off in Perth on February 6, Fanny and her band The Prawn Stars will traverse the country with shows in Adelaide, Melbourne, Brisbane and Sydney, wrapping the tour in Canberra on February 21. Fanny said today, “We have had the time of our lives opening for Paul Kelly and Lucinda Williiams around Australia, and playing so many incredible shows through Europe and the UK that we couldn't help but keep the joy going and bring our very fun/silly show filled with incredible musicianship and harmonies by my band, stories and joy to cities around the country. Plus, we have so many new songs and stories to share!”

Fanny’s recent shows in Europe included a triumphant 23-date headline tour, a sold-out Country Halls tour in Scotland, no less than 7 festivals plus a support slot with fellow Australian singer songwriter Paul Kelly. Her performances garnered praise with local press with the UK’s Entertainment Focus choosing her as one of its Top Ten highlights following her opening set on the main stage at the prestigious The Long Road Festival in Leicestershire, quoting “It’s obvious she loves the UK audience... and that feeling seemed very much mutual, so I hope it won’t be too long until she’s back.”
Country In The UK, in its Ones To Watch feature, stated: “the most uplifting set that you will see all weekend which is guaranteed to put the biggest smile on your face.” She was also chosen for the BBC’s live coverage from Belladrum Festival in Scotland. At the conclusion of her extensive European touring schedule, Fanny then immediately jumped onto a plane to head home to Australia for her opening slot on Paul Kelly’s Antipodean Arena Tour with Lucinda Williams-with her reputation as “the hardest working woman in showbiz” firmly intact!
